Transaction aafecd741f2903c18acd55e546c47ed32286fb2951e24705f98820816a8ec2f2
1 Input
1 Output
-
aafecd741f2903c18acd55e546c47ed32286fb2951e24705f98820816a8ec2f2:0
- value
- 26677710
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 095ae362c739c027270d00a986cac34c8e931ad2 OP_EQUAL
- address
- M8kdCBUC2KbW2P3RdajDvuFGvnkV9QoHhr